| has gloss | eng: The Michigan Journal of Business is a bi-annually published academic journal run by undergraduate students at the Stephen M. Ross School of Business at the University of Michigan. Founded in 2007, the Journal is the first undergraduate business journal in the United States with a worldwide audience, being distributed to over 200 University libraries in five continents. The Journal publishes distinguished theses, empirical research, case studies, and theories in issues relating to areas of Accounting, Economics, Finance, Marketing, Management, Operations Management, Information Systems, Business Law, Corporate Ethics, and Public Policy. The Journal was accepted into the Directories of Open Access Journals (DOAJ), a scholarly journal database that enlists more than 3000 of the world’s leading publications. |
